According to a PSB press release, the financial assistance comes as a crucial support to ensure the team\u2019s performance and competitiveness at the international level. Before the national outfit\u2019s departure to China, the PHF top brass had revealed that the federation was suffering from scarcity of funds and had to rely on loan to arrange team\u2019s participation in the coveted event. The federation, however was assured that the Board would reimburse the said amount. The Ministry of Inter-Provincial Coordination (IPC) and PSB also released a special grant of Rs. 96.65 million to the PHF in the last six months for participating in different international tournaments, reinforcing its commitment to the development of hockey in Pakistan. This financial support is yet another sign of commitment of PSB in promoting hockey and fostering a competitive environment for Pakistan\u2019s athletes on the international stage. In the Asian Champions Trophy semifinal, Pakistan conceded defeat on penalty shootout against hosts China.However, they managed to make a podium finish, beating Korea 5-2 in the bronze-medal match.
